一、技术演进背景:从单点工具到全场景智能交互
传统智能助手开发面临三大核心挑战:跨平台兼容性差、任务执行依赖特定API、自然语言理解能力有限。某主流云服务商近期推出的全场景智能交互云服务,通过整合大模型推理能力与异构系统对接技术,构建了新一代智能体开发框架。
该框架突破性地将智能体划分为三层架构:
- 通讯协议层:支持主流IM平台的消息协议解析,包括但不限于企业级即时通讯、短信网关、邮件服务等
- 任务执行层:内置可扩展的插件系统,支持数据库操作、API调用、文件处理等企业级操作
- 认知决策层:集成多模态大模型,实现意图理解、上下文记忆、多轮对话管理
技术架构图示:
┌───────────────┐ ┌───────────────┐ ┌───────────────┐│ 通讯协议层 │──→│ 任务执行层 │──→│ 认知决策层 │└───────────────┘ └───────────────┘ └───────────────┘↑ ↑ ↑┌───────────────┐ ┌───────────────┐ ┌───────────────┐│ 第三方IM平台 │ │ 企业业务系统 │ │ 大模型服务 │└───────────────┘ └───────────────┘ └───────────────┘
二、核心能力解析:构建企业级智能体的三大支柱
1. 跨平台消息路由机制
服务采用消息总线架构,支持同时对接多个通讯渠道。开发者只需配置平台接入参数,即可实现:
- 消息格式自动转换(Markdown/富文本/纯文本)
- 用户身份统一映射(跨平台用户ID关联)
- 消息状态同步(已读/未读/处理中)
示例配置代码:
channels:- type: enterprise_imendpoint: im.example.comapp_key: your_app_keytransformers:- markdown_to_text- type: smsgateway: sms.provider.comtemplate_id: order_status
2. 动态任务编排引擎
基于工作流描述语言(WDL),支持可视化编排复杂任务流程。关键特性包括:
- 条件分支:根据大模型评估结果选择执行路径
- 异常处理:自动重试机制与人工介入通道
- 状态追踪:全流程日志与执行状态可视化
典型应用场景示例:
用户发送"查询订单状态" →1. 解析订单号 →2. 调用ERP系统API →3. 判断物流状态 →4. 生成个性化回复 →5. 同步状态至CRM系统
3. 大模型增强型交互
集成多模态认知能力,实现三大交互升级:
- 意图理解:支持模糊查询与上下文关联
- 多轮对话:记忆历史对话上下文
- 主动学习:自动收集未覆盖场景数据
实测数据显示,在订单查询场景中,该框架将用户问题理解准确率从78%提升至92%,任务完成率从65%提升至89%。
三、开发实践指南:从零构建智能体应用
1. 环境准备与快速启动
开发环境要求:
- Python 3.8+
- 云服务SDK(通过官方仓库安装)
- 至少4核8G计算资源
初始化项目命令:
pip install cloud-agent-sdkagent-cli init my_first_agentcd my_first_agent
2. 核心组件开发
a. 消息处理器开发
from cloud_agent import MessageHandlerclass OrderQueryHandler(MessageHandler):def handle(self, context):order_id = context.extract_entity("order_id")status = self.call_api("erp.get_order_status", order_id)return f"订单{order_id}当前状态:{status}"
b. 工作流定义
workflows:order_query:steps:- handler: OrderQueryHandlerretry: 3timeout: 10- handler: NotificationSenderconditions:- status == "shipped"
3. 调试与部署
服务提供完整的开发套件:
- 本地模拟器:支持离线调试
- 日志分析系统:实时追踪执行状态
- 灰度发布机制:分阶段上线新功能
部署架构建议:
┌───────────────┐ ┌───────────────┐│ 开发环境 │──→│ 测试环境 │└───────────────┘ └───────────────┘↓ ↓┌───────────────┐ ┌───────────────┐│ 预发布环境 │──→│ 生产环境 │└───────────────┘ └───────────────┘
四、典型应用场景与效益分析
1. 客户服务自动化
某电商企业部署后实现:
- 70%常见问题自动处理
- 人工客服工作量下降45%
- 平均响应时间从12分钟缩短至8秒
2. 内部流程优化
某制造企业通过该框架:
- 整合8个业务系统API
- 实现设备报修全流程自动化
- 年度运维成本降低230万元
3. 数据分析增强
某金融机构构建的智能体:
- 自动生成日报周报
- 异常交易实时预警
- 报告生成效率提升30倍
五、技术演进趋势与挑战
当前框架仍面临三大发展方向:
- 多智能体协作:构建智能体社会网络
- 边缘计算部署:降低时延敏感型应用响应时间
- 隐私保护增强:支持联邦学习与差分隐私
开发者需重点关注:
- 大模型微调技术
- 异构系统对接标准
- 安全合规框架
该全场景智能交互云服务的推出,标志着企业智能化转型进入新阶段。通过标准化开发框架与预集成能力,开发者可更专注于业务逻辑实现,而非底层技术细节。随着框架生态的完善,预计将催生更多创新应用场景,推动智能体技术从辅助工具向生产力平台演进。